Bio

Stone sculptor based in Charente-Maritime, Sandrine Chaille primarily works with limestone, particularly the Thénac stone extracted from Saintonge. Her sculptures vary between figurative and abstract, depending on her creative impulses. Originally trained in housing renovation, she previously held the position of manager in a masonry company specializing in habitat renovation with rubble stones. Currently, she works as a technical assistant in a building classified as a historical monument in France. For the past few years, she has been a member of ARTOUR, an association of sculptors in Charente-Maritime near La Rochelle. She works and evolves in public view every week, surrounded by professionals and enthusiasts.
